## Deploying the Gatewick Proctor Queue

Deploys are pretty painless: push to main, wait for the pipeline, then watch the queue drain dashboard for five minutes. If candidates pile up mid-exam, roll back first and ask questions later — the queue replays safely. Everything the workers care about lives in one config block, shown here for reference.

settings of bafof-yagef:
JOROX_PIN=8740
JOROX_TENANT=pelox
JOROX_METRICS_HOST=metrics.jorox.qorvelworks.internal
JOROX_SEAL=seal_c78f63c1
JOROX_STANDBY_TEAM=norax

## Orders "missing" from the orders table

Heads up: Cartwheel uses soft deletes. A cancelled order gets deleted_at set — it's still there, just filtered out by the default scope. If a customer swears an order vanished, query with deleted rows included before panicking.

To pull soft-deleted rows through the admin API, use the read-only bearer token below.

session JWT of yawep-yawep = eyJhbGciOiJIUzI1NiIsInR5cCI6IkpXVCJ9.eyJzdWIiOiI3pWF3_In0.aXYsHiog

Q: How are firmware updates delivered to Bramblepoint devices?

A: Updates ship over the Hollytide channel, signed with an offline root key and verified on-device before install. Devices poll twice daily with jittered intervals; staged rollout holds at 5% for 24 hours pending telemetry review. Rollback images are retained for two prior versions. The channel's key rotation schedule and verification logs are documented on the internal security page.

runbook for badug-kadup: https://confluence.zemvarlabs.internal/projects/browse/display/projects/bd1b